Transaction 95165c8434fa4cd457db136ced46a265cd14ffdfdbe59c7766a062534c77a484

32 Input
2 Outputs
  • 95165c8434fa4cd457db136ced46a265cd14ffdfdbe59c7766a062534c77a484:0
  • value  20601
    address  1LaiuDDnJYpGTbUHYHtzud29dKLNKMo2cs
  • 95165c8434fa4cd457db136ced46a265cd14ffdfdbe59c7766a062534c77a484:1
  • value  1034000000
    address  1LPgpZfdtRAK5b2EJtwsXds5JwSXh8opG5